Cleveland Restaurant Says They Were ‘Bullied’ Into Putting Genders on Their Restrooms | Eater

"A Cleveland restaurant that opened less than a year ago and serves alcohol had been operating with gender-neutral, single-stall restrooms labeled by fixture (urinal/toilet). During an inspection primarily for a new patio, an inspector cited an Ohio requirement that restaurants serving liquor have “two complete restrooms (one for each sex)” and demanded clear M and W gender markers, warning the owner that their liquor license could be at risk—a prospect the owner said would cripple the business and make it impossible to pay staff. The restaurant publicly criticized the demand as bullying on Instagram, saying customers had praised and photographed the gender-neutral bathrooms for safety and shorter waits; the Ohio Department of Commerce later said the permit was never in danger, and after national attention the Superintendent of Liquor Control called to resolve a misunderstanding and the painted M and W markings were removed. The owner says the business will comply with the law as written while fighting the requirement behind the scenes and will not enforce gendered usage of facilities." - Madeleine Davies

Good food and good company, the foundation of any great restaurant. Fortunately Good Company provides ample of both, along with being supremely located in the Battery Park neighborhood, a stone's throw away from Edgewater. Did I also mention that they have a free parking lot? The restaurant is playful but trendy, and manages to appeal to both the sports-fanatic (TVs behind the bar) as well as the friend who's a better person than you that doesn't eat meat. While their dinner sandwiches like the Gabagool are what put them on the Diners, Drive-Ins, and Dives map, I'm a staunch believer that Good Company's brunch can throw down with the best of them and could potentially be better than their dinner?? The crowd pleasing breakfast burrito comes in both meat and vegan options, and you can even savor their winsome 72-hour chicken wings in the mornings too. Their wings quite literally fall off the bone, and are evenly coated with whatever delectable sauce you choose - don't skip them. Any of their smashburger variants also hits the spot. Not super hungry? Snack on the pretzels or loaded fries. Their desserts and shakes are quite popular and can be packaged to go, but somehow my stomach never quite makes it there. Service-wise, everyone is friendly but not overbearing and generally leaves you be once you order. That's not to say they don't care about the customers - take a look in either of the all-gender bathrooms and you'll see them stocked with feminine hygiene products and even a changing station.
